Frequently asked questions

Is Milwaukee cheaper than Minneapolis?

Yes. Milwaukee has a cost of living index of 89 vs 106 for Minneapolis (100 = US average). That's about 16% cheaper.

How much will I save moving from Minneapolis to Milwaukee?

On a $75K salary, moving from Minneapolis to Milwaukee saves roughly $488/month on core expenses. That's ~$5,856/year.

What salary do I need in Milwaukee to match my Minneapolis lifestyle?

To maintain the same purchasing power as $75,000 in Minneapolis, you'd need roughly $62,972/year in Milwaukee. This is based on the overall COL index difference.
